ZIP 07735 is wealthier than most US places, with a median household income of $97,536. Population has held roughly steady since 2024. Median home value is $406,000. Poverty is rare here, at 5.8% of residents. Among the 48 ZIP codes in Monmouth County, 07735 ranks 41st by median household income.
